The Front Seat Head Restraint problem

The contact owns a 2010 Buick Lucerne. The contact stated that the front driver's headrest was not designed properly and remained tilted forward while driving, causing tension in the neck area. The dealer and manufacturer were notified of the failure. The approximate failure mileage was 2,000.   Read details...

The Front Seat Power Adjust problem

The contact owns a 2010 Buick Lucerne. While driving approximately 65 mph he adjusted the driver's seat and the seat went back down to the floor. He stated that the electrical seat will not stay where it was set. The vehicle was taken to the dealer on five occasions and they cannot fix the problem.   Read details...
